Designing for Delivery
Too often, architectural plans are created in a vacuum—elegant on paper, but disconnected from real-world timelines, budgets, and constraints. At Edge, our work begins with vision, but it's shaped by experience. We think like architects and builders, balancing inspiration with constructability from day one.
From the very first sketches, we:
Consider phasing and scheduling impacts
Align designs with available funding mechanisms (including grants)
Think through systems, materials, and maintenance
Anticipate code and regulatory pathways
The result? Designs that are ambitious and achievable.
The Edge Approach in Action
We’ve seen time and again that the earlier we're involved, the more value we can bring.
With Bridges for Brain Injury, we developed a comprehensive masterplan that captured their full vision for a newly acquired property—then strategically broke it into manageable, fundable phases to be implemented over time.
For Webster Montessori School, our design-build approach meant aligning design decisions with real-time construction costs at every stage. Through proactive value engineering and careful material selection, we ensured the project remained on budget and on schedule—even within a constrained construction window.
Across both projects, the outcome is the same: thoughtful design grounded in real-world delivery. Our clients move forward with confidence, clarity, and momentum.
